    Is it feasible to connect a video recorder to a Satellite M70 in order to transfer video tape recordings to DVD? If it is, what cable do I need?

    Hi there,
    since your notebook is only equipped with an TV-OUT, you cannot just connect a video recorder to your machine, because to do this you will need an Video-IN.
    The only chance you have is to purchase a external video grabber for PCMCIA or USB.
    With such Video Grabber youre able to receive external video signals and to record/edit them.

  • Satellite M70-168 : new HD and OEM license

    Hi,
    My Satellite is out of garantee .....
    Original HD (80 gb) has broken, and it's impossible to find the same HD.
    I will replace by a HGST Travelstar 5K750 HTS547575A9E384 - HD - 750 Go - SATA-300 .
    1 - I think that Sata 2 (sata 300) is compatible, but works at only at speed of sata 1 (sata 150) . Is it a problem ?
    2 - Can I restore the OS on this HD with the DVD created on the first run, does the OEM license permit this job, or block the restore ?
    Sorry for my poor language ... Frenchie is Frenchie ....
    Great thanks .
    Solved!
    Go to Solution.

    Satellite M70-168 (PSM70E-02001NEN)
    You should be able to restore the hard disk to its original out-of-the-box contents using the Toshiba recovery DVD. See the section Restoring the preinstalled software on p. 3-11 of the User's Manual (attached).
    If the new disc has advanced-format technology, you may have difficulty. Try to get one without it.

  • How do I use airplay to stream a DVD movie playing in my computer to display on my TV?

    How do I use airplay to stream a DVD movie playing in my computer to display on my TV?
    I have a 2nd generation Apple TV and computer is a 2011 Macbook Pro. Processor  2.8 GHz Intel Core i7. Memory  4 GB 1333 MHz DDR3. Graphics  Intel HD Graphics 3000 384 MB. Software  Mac OS X Lion 10.7.5 (11G63). Storage: about 500GB free out of 750GB.
    I have a DVD player within my computer. Trying to play a movie from my computer to display onto my TV using my Apple TV airplay. But the airplay icon is not showing or giving the option to play a movie onto my TV.
    I've installed all software updates and still I'm not able to have this functionality.
    I assume this functionality exists where I can play a DVD on my computer, but watch it on my TV using my Apple TV, correct?
    Thanks for your help solving this puzzle.

    Welcome to the Apple Community.
    AirPlay Mirroring requires a second-generation Apple TV or later, OS X 10.8 or better and is supported on the following Mac models: iMac (Mid 2011 or newer), Mac mini (Mid 2011 or newer), MacBook Air (Mid 2011 or newer), and MacBook Pro (Early 2011 or newer). You can see which Mac you have and which operating system you are using by selecting 'About this Mac' from the Apple menu in the top left corner of your Mac and selecting the 'More Info' button.
    AirPlay Mirroring from a Mac also requires a fairly robust network.
